LINX Camps' Science Staff "Rock Stars" Inspire Upham Elementary Students for the Upham Invention Convention to be held March 26th

WELLESLEY, MA – March 25 – LINX Camps hosted a hands-on science fair at Upham Elementary School, 35 Wynnewood Road, Wellesley, on February 25th, to create excitement and inspire students as they prepare for their upcoming Invention Convention, to be held March 26, 2014 at Upham Elementary.

LINX Camps long-time and respected science staff favorites, Chris “Cornbread” Coimbra and Chris Dumais, engaged Upham students after school in the library with an interactive science show that included “Mega Toilet Paper Throwing Machines,” “Elephant’s Toothpaste,” “Rockets” and more.  The goal of the show was to inspire the imaginations of the young students as they prepare for their own Invention Convention in the Upham gym on March 26th.  Upham Science Fair Coordinator Susan Cracraft was very pleased with the effort stating, “LINX put on a fantastic show for our Brainstorming Session to inspire the students for our Invention Convention.  Many of the kids already knew Mr. Josh, Chris, and Cornbread from attending LINX camp in the summer so they were excited before the show even began.  I walked through the halls of Upham with Chris and Cornbread and it was like walking with 2 rockstars, the kids were calling their names and giving them high fives!  Even more amazing was that Chris and Cornbread knew the kids names too."  Josh Schiering, Vice President/Executive Director of LINX and LX Summer Camps, commends Coimbra and Dumais for inspiring the students in their passion for science.  “LINX Science Camps was so happy to see so many Upham students at the recent brainstorming session led by the LINX Science team. The kids were cheering while being challenged to think outside the box for their own science projects for their fair coming up in late March. I was proud of the science team as they took everyday projects and turned them into WOW moments for the students. LINX Science Camps always goes BIG! Each science fair participant is also receiving a LINX Camps Science Gift Certificate they can use towards camp this summer to build on their passion for science!" To add to the excitement of the March 26th event, Coimbra and Dumais will be on hand as “special guest scientists.”

LINX will donate a week of LINX Camp or 5 $100 gift certificates.  To further inspire students to participate in the Invention Convention, LINX has promised that each participant in the science show will receive a complimentary sample science class at LINX as a prize for entering.  In addition, each entrant at the Invention Convention on March 26th will be awarded a $50 LINX Camps gift certificate.  "Linx generously donated their time and materials to host our Brainstorming Session which was the kick off for our Invention Convention.  They did an amazing job of getting the kids fired up about science and we had the largest number of entries ever for this year's Invention Convention.  I can't thank them enough for their help!" said Cracraft.

LINX has always been an advocate of hands-on fun science learning, offering a LINX Science Camp every year.  Young campers in Kindergarten through 8th grade are led on a science adventure.  Projects vary from week to week as campers take hands on look at solar energy, hybrid technology, hydroelectric and wind power, and more.  A typical day at Science Camp includes three science intensives, a lunch period, a swim period (including Red Cross Certified swim instruction), and a bonus camp activity period.  The camp, located at LINX’s Dana Hall Campus in Wellesley, consists of weekly full day sessions (9am – 4pm), starting July 7th and ending on August 15th.  For more information on LINX Science Camp, visit www.linxcamps.com/SpecialtyCamps/Science or call 781-235-3210.
